Output 3ccf009db8621bcaa4fe30df0da524d34a26b970b07d3fe269d2fc8c97ccaa62:0

value
49992020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89ce8df6defcafcf3d74ea67dbb572d4bd2f787c OP_EQUAL
address
3EFfwV9bqkwcKxTNNaFYpcCb217ay8HX3k
transaction
3ccf009db8621bcaa4fe30df0da524d34a26b970b07d3fe269d2fc8c97ccaa62
confirmations
11404
spent
true